How Much Is Car Insurance for a Hyundai Azera?
Car insurance for a Hyundai Azera costs around $156 per month for full coverage and approximately $86 per month for minimum coverage. Your final rate depends on factors like your driving history, your age, where you live, and the coverage you select.

Comparing Insurance Costs for Hyundai Azera to Other Sedans
Even among full-size sedans, insurance prices can vary more than you might expect. Repair costs, safety features, and claim history all influence what drivers end up paying. The Hyundai Azera generally falls in a moderate range compared to similar vehicles.
| Make/Model | Annual Full Coverage Insurance |
|---|---|
| Hyundai Azera | $1,880 |
| Toyota Avalon | $1,738 |
| Chevrolet Impala | $1,588 |
| Nissan Maxima | $1,910 |
| Chrysler 300 | $1,720 |
| Ford Taurus | $1,628 |
Types of Car Insurance Coverage for a Full-size Sedan
When you’re choosing coverage for your Hyundai Azera, it helps to think about how you actually drive and what you’d want to happen if something goes wrong. The type of auto insurance you pick should match your routine—whether you’re on the road every day or only drive occasionally.
Some drivers choose the minimum coverage to stay legal, while others prefer extra protection to avoid unexpected expenses. Below, we explain the features of the main coverage options.
Full Coverage
Full car coverage combines liability, collision, and comprehensive insurance. It gives you broader protection, covering accident-related damage as well as situations like theft, vandalism, storm damage, or a cracked windshield.
If you use your Azera often, full coverage can save you from paying large repair bills out of pocket after an accident. It’s especially helpful when your car is still in good shape and you want to keep it that way. State Minimum Liability
Think of state minimum liability as coverage for the damage you cause to others, not for your own vehicle. It’s the most basic level of insurance required by law, focusing on paying for bodily injuries and property damage when you’re responsible for an accident.
For example, if you rear-end another car at a red light, this coverage can pay for the other driver’s medical bills and repairs to their vehicle. However, any damage to your own car would need to be paid out of pocket unless you also have collision coverage.
Each state sets its own liability insurance limits. In Georgia, for example, drivers are required to carry at least a 25/50/25 policy, which applies to bodily injuries and property damage. Since Georgia is an at-fault state, the driver who causes the accident is financially responsible for covering those costs.
Individual Factors That Influence Pricing for a Hyundai Azera
When insurers calculate your rate, they look at different factors, for example, the theft statistics for your type of vehicle. Unfortunately, some Hyundai models top the list of the most stolen vehicles in the USA, and this statistic is combined with others related to where you live and other aspects such as your vehicle’s safety features.
In addition to this, here are some other elements that can affect what you pay for your coverage:
- Marital status: Married drivers often receive lower rates.
- Credit score: In many states, stronger credit can mean better pricing.
- Education level: Some insurers factor education into their pricing models.
- Annual mileage: Driving fewer miles per year can help lower your premium.
- Where you live: Rates are higher in areas with more accidents or theft.
Because everyone’s situation is different, comparing quotes is one of the best ways to avoid paying more than you should.

How Does a DUI Affect Insurance Rates?
A DUI doesn’t just affect your driving record—it changes how insurance companies see your overall risk. After a DUI, insurers often assume there’s a higher chance of future claims, which is why rates usually increase, sometimes significantly, even if you haven’t had issues or tickets before.
In addition, some insurers may decide not to continue your policy, while others will still offer coverage but at a higher price. In many states, you’ll also be asked to file an SR-22, which is a form that shows you’re meeting the state’s minimum insurance requirements.
